Bellevista Are »Telefou 92168 TWO GRAND SUMMER EXCURSIONS As usual, the Cunard White Star Line is planning two ex cursions this summer on their largest steamer BERENGARIA popular among our nationals who are familiar with the ad vantages of joining an ex cursion that is personally es corted by an experienced Tra vel Conductor. One of this excursions is on May 28th which will be con ducted by Mr. Alfred Markus, popular among the readers of our paper. No doubt, many of you have previously made trips escorted by Mr. Markus. The other excursion is on the same steamer which leaves New York on June 17th like wise escorted by an experienc ed travel conductor who has established a very favorable reputation among travellers who have joined his excursion in the past The advantages of joining such an excursion is also that you are travelling among people of your own kind and nationality. You are relieved from all travel worries as the conductor takes care of all the necessary steps incidental to a visit to the old country such as baggage, passport, railroad transportation, etc. There is plenty of entertainment and amusement aboard the ship so that time flies fast. Railroad trip from Cher bourg takes you through Pa ris where you have a chance to see this wonder city and by express you will continue through the beautiful Alps to your destination which is not much more than an overnight trip. A visit to the old country at this time of the year has many advantages. You are just in time to indulge in many fest ivals and other affairs that leave a pleasant memory. o 44 E.
